A testosterone level of 70 (measured in ng/dL) can be considered low, especially for adult males. Low testosterone can affect energy, mood, and overall health. It's advisable to consult with a healthcare provider for a thorough evaluation and to discuss potential treatments or lifestyle changes to address this issue.

FAQs & Answers

  1. What are the symptoms of low testosterone in men? Symptoms may include fatigue, mood changes, low libido, and reduced muscle mass.
  2. How can I naturally increase my testosterone levels? Natural methods include regular exercise, a healthy diet, quality sleep, and managing stress.
  3. When should I consult a healthcare provider about testosterone levels? Consult a healthcare provider if you experience symptoms like low energy, mood swings, or changes in libido.
  4. What treatments are available for low testosterone? Treatments may include lifestyle changes, hormone therapy, and medications as prescribed by a healthcare provider.
